Bleu Berries Strain Overview

Bleu Berries is an indica-dominant hybrid cannabis strain known for its distinctive blueberry aroma and relaxing effects. The strain is believed to have originated from crossing Blueberry, a classic indica strain developed by breeder DJ Short in the 1970s, with another indica or indica-dominant variety, though its exact lineage is sometimes debated among cultivators. It gained popularity in the late 1990s and early 2000s, particularly in North American and European markets, for its flavorful profile and potent, calming high. The strain is often associated with artisanal or boutique breeding projects, though it is not as widely commercialized as its parent Blueberry.

Visually, Bleu Berries plants typically exhibit dense, resinous buds with a mix of deep green and purple hues, often accentuated by vibrant orange pistils. The purple coloration is more pronounced in cooler growing conditions, a trait inherited from its Blueberry ancestry. The buds are usually covered in a thick layer of trichomes, giving them a frosty appearance. Notable features include its strong sweet and berry-like scent, reminiscent of fresh blueberries, with subtle earthy and floral undertones. The flavor profile is similarly fruity and smooth, making it a favorite among users who prioritize taste.

Bleu Berries is considered a moderately potent strain with effects that are predominantly relaxing and sedating, though it may also induce mild euphoria. It is often used in the evening or at night due to its tendency to promote sleepiness. While not as historically significant as Blueberry, it has maintained a niche following among indica enthusiasts. As with many cannabis strains, precise genetic details can vary between different breeders' versions, and some phenotypes may exhibit slightly different characteristics. Consumers should verify the source and testing information when available, as THC levels and terpene profiles can differ based on cultivation practices.

Bleu Berries Strain Growing Information

Bleu Berries is considered a moderate-difficulty strain to cultivate, suitable for growers with some experience. It has a flowering time of approximately 8 to 9 weeks indoors, with outdoor harvests typically ready in late September to early October in the Northern Hemisphere. Yields are moderate, averaging around 400-500 grams per square meter indoors or 500-600 grams per plant outdoors. The plant prefers a temperate climate with low humidity to prevent mold, and it can be grown both indoors and outdoors, though indoor cultivation allows better control over temperature and lighting. Plants tend to be short to medium in height, often staying under 1.5 meters, with a bushy, indica-typical structure. Special considerations include providing cool nighttime temperatures during the flowering stage to enhance purple coloration and ensuring good airflow to protect the dense buds from pests and fungal issues. It responds well to training techniques like topping or low-stress training to improve yields.
